Four repair levels
Safe Repair recalculates header and final CRC values when the declared file is otherwise intact. Smart Repair only patches conservative, locally detectable record anomalies with writable source fields. Salvage preserves every complete original message before a damaged tail. Compatibility Rebuild creates a new standardized Activity FIT from recovered Record messages.
What a rebuild may omit
A compatibility rebuild prioritizes the core workout streams that were recovered. Manufacturer-specific developer fields, some proprietary metadata, original lap/event structure and extensions may not survive the rebuilt copy. Always keep the original file.
